The global economy is undergoing an unprecedented transformation, driven by rapid digitalization and the widespread adoption of mobile technologies. Mobile networks and digital infrastructure have become the backbone of economic growth, fostering seamless connectivity, enhanced productivity, and innovative business models. The significance of the mobile economy extends beyond mere technological advancement—it is fundamentally reshaping industries, commerce, and governance at an international scale.
According to the GSMA Mobile Economy Report, mobile technologies and services contributed approximately $5.8 trillion to global GDP in 2025, equating to nearly 5.8% of total economic output. By 2030, this figure is projected to surge to nearly $11 trillion, reinforcing the indispensable role of mobile networks, digital transformation, and intelligent connectivity in driving economic expansion. Countries and enterprises that embrace this shift will be at the forefront of global competitiveness, innovation, and sustainable development.
Key Features of the Mobile Economy
The mobile economy is defined by several transformative characteristics that are shaping the future of digital ecosystems worldwide:
Ubiquitous Connectivity
The proliferation of smartphones and mobile broadband has enabled seamless global communication. As of 2024, there were over 5.5 billion unique mobile subscribers, with penetration expected to reach 70% of the global population by 2030. High-speed mobile internet ensures that businesses, individuals, and governments can operate efficiently, regardless of geographic location.
The Evolution of 5G and Beyond
The introduction of 5G networks has revolutionized connectivity, enabling ultra-low latency, massive data transmission capabilities, and enhanced network reliability. Beyond traditional applications, 5G facilitates:
- Smart cities, optimizing traffic control, public safety, and energy management.
- Industry 4.0, enhancing automation, precision manufacturing, and AI-powered supply chain operations.
- Next-generation entertainment, delivering immersive AR/VR experiences and cloud gaming.
- Autonomous mobility, supporting self-driving cars, drones, and smart transportation solutions.
AI and IoT Integration
Artificial intelligence (AI) and the Internet of Things (IoT) are transforming industries by automating processes, enhancing decision-making, and enabling predictive analytics. The global IoT market is expected to reach $1.5 trillion by 2030, driven by advancements in smart healthcare, logistics, and agriculture.
Cloud and Edge Computing
Decentralized computing models, such as cloud and edge computing, are redefining data processing and storage. These technologies ensure faster access to information, lower latency, and enhanced cybersecurity.
